About The Position

Gexpro Services is looking for an Inside Sales Account Manager to fill an immediate opening. The qualified Inside Sales Account Manager must possess a high school diploma or GED and have a combination of relevant experience in a customer-facing role, processing sales orders. A qualified candidate will be able to perform the following task: Processes customer orders by quoting product prices, delivery specifications, and payment terms and by offering substitute products where appropriate. Sourcing new sales opportunities through inbound lead follow-up and outbound cold calls and emails. Communicating with customers to understand their needs, identify sales opportunities, and source products to process sales orders and monitor customer fulfillment. Research and report pricing, products, and current/future market trends information. Processes product quotations and provides continuous follow up throughout the completion of the customer's purchasing cycle. Handle multiple customer inquiries, process orders, and resolve customer issues promptly using root-cause analysis.
